Beep13 Posted May 9, 2007 Report Share Posted May 9, 2007 Just wondering, I know with stock navigation and internal antenna (built into car or rear windshield) if you tint you windows your reception is affected. Just wondering, with the nav units (like z1 or d3), if I have my antenna mounted internally and I have my windows tinted will the reception be affected? LUNARFX Posted May 9, 2007 Report Share Posted May 9, 2007 I have my antenna mounted on the dash in the corner where the windshield meets on the same side as the A-pillar. My entire windshield is tinted 15% and the rest of my windows are 5%. The navigation works just perfectly.. Quote Link to post Share on other sites
Itchy Posted May 9, 2007 Report Share Posted May 9, 2007 It depends on the type of tint used. film & ceramic based do not impede signal sensitivity. metallic based tints will impede sensitivity. Quote Link to post Share on other sites
stoneycase Posted May 25, 2007 Report Share Posted May 25, 2007 It depends on the type of tint used. film & ceramic based do not impede signal sensitivity. metallic based tints will impede sensitivity. most good tint mfr's will say specifically "does not impede GPS signal"... it's this way with all 3M tints, including the high performance color stable line. i think their FX line of tint claims no signal interference as well.
